Cheap Eurostar to Budapest

To find cheap train tickets for your next journeys to Budapest with Eurostar find below several hints and tips that you need to know before buying your rail ticket.

Eurostar tickets to Budapest are available for sale up to 6 months before your travel. Eurostar fares are similar to air fares: if you book at the last minute prices are higher than if you anticipate. So the earlier you book the more likely you are to get a great fare. The best time to start looking the Eurostar ticket prices to Budapest is 6 months before.

The train company Eurostar allow you to travel with three different types of tickets depending on the flexibility offer: flexible, semi-flexible and non-flexible. Ticket prices vary depending on the type of flexibility you select. Non-flexible tickets to Budapest are cheaper than the other ticket types, but your ticket cannot be exchanged and you will not be refunded. So you need to be certain to travel to Budapest on the day selected.

There are several classes of travel on board Eurostar services: Standard, Standard Premier or Business Premier. If you choose to spend your trip in Standard class to go to Budapest the price will be cheaper compared to a ticket in Business Premier Class.

Moreover, throughout the year Eurostar offers reductions allow you to travel by rail for cheaper. Frequently Eurostar offers return tickets for £59.00 instead of £69.00, a saving of 15% for a travel between Paris and London for instance. Travel information Eurostar to Budapest

When you travel with Eurostar to Budapest, you need to take your passport or a national identity card to go through security checks, both in the UK and in Europe. Don't forget that you are crossing the Channel, so one of these identity documents is required. If you travel with children they need their own passport.

One of the benefits of travelling to Budapest with Eurostar is that there is no luggage weight restriction. The only condition is that you have to be able to carry your own bags onto the train. Adults can take 2 bags (up to 85cm long) and 1 item of hand luggage free.

At the station you need to check in beforehand: the time you need to check in depends on the Eurostar travel class you have chosen. Check in 30 minutes before departure for Standard and Standard Premier travel class. Check in just 10 minutes before departure for Business Premier travel class.
